Manual docketing is a liability
When deadlines live in a spreadsheet or someone's calendar, the practice carries silent risk: a formula that wasn't updated, a reminder that went to the wrong person, a date entered a year late. In IP, that risk has a name — malpractice exposure.
IPBases turns docketing into a system. Renewal and action dates are derived from the matter itself, tracked centrally, and shown to the right people before they fall due.
